Type Samms 709 Heavy-Duty Flat Car for "Permanent Roadway", DBSR, Era VI.

Prototype: DB Schenker Rail (DBSR) type Samms 709 6-axle heavy-duty flat car. Loaded with concrete parts for the "Feste Fahrbahn" / "Permanent Roadway" from the firm Max Bögl. The car looks as it currently does in real life.

Product description

Model: The frame of this heavy-duty flat car is constructed of metal. The car has special three-axle trucks. It also has a reproduction of concrete parts for the "Feste Fahrbahn" / "Permanent Roadway". Length over the buffers 18.9 cm / 7-7/16". DC wheel set 6 x 700580.

This model is appearing in 2013 as a one-time series and is available exclusively at VEDES specialty shops as long as supplies last.
